UNLV Miraculously Survives Utah State in Double Overtime Thriller, 29-26

In a heart-stopping double-overtime thriller that will be etched into Mountain West Conference lore, the UNLV Rebels miraculously survived a determined Utah State Aggies squad 29-26 on Saturday night at Allegiant Stadium. The victory, sealed not by a flawless offensive masterpiece but by a combination of gritty defensive stands and a staggering trio of missed field goals from Utah State's usually reliable kicker Tanner Rinker, was a testament to the chaotic, unpredictable beauty of college football.Quarterback Anthony Colandrea, while not operating at peak efficiency, once again proved his mettle as the Rebels' field general, passing for 276 yards and delivering a moment of pure brilliance with a perfectly placed touchdown dart to wide receiver DaeDae Reynolds in the back of the endzone to seize the lead in the third quarter. His dual-threat capability was on full display, though the Aggies' defense managed to contain his rushing impact, sacking him three times.With lead back Jai’den Thomas unexpectedly sidelined, the running back committee of Jaylon Glover and Keyvone Lee faced an uphill battle, managing to grind out necessary yards without replicating the explosive efficiency of previous weeks. The receiving corps, led by the steady hands of Jaden Bradley and the big-play ability of Troy Omeire, who hauled in a spectacular 48-yard catch, created opportunities, though late-game miscommunications nearly proved costly.The real drama, however, unfolded in the game's dying moments and the subsequent overtimes. After UNLV kicker Ramon Villela shockingly missed a 39-yard field goal in the first overtime period, the game seemed destined for a heartbreaking conclusion.Yet, the narrative flipped entirely onto the shoulders of Utah State's Rinker, who entered the contest with a perfect record. The psychological weight of an early miss seemed to cripple his confidence, leading to a catastrophic wide-right miss from 44 yards as regulation expired, followed by another agonizing miss from 41 yards in the first overtime that directly handed UNLV a lifeline.This sequence was a brutal lesson in football analytics; while advanced metrics often focus on yards per play and quarterback ratings, the simple, high-leverage execution of the kicking game remains the ultimate volatility factor. It was a failure that overshadowed a Herculean effort from Utah State quarterback Bryson Barnes, who amassed 380 total yards and accounted for two touchdowns, slicing through the Rebels' defense with both his arm and his legs, including a breathtaking 58-yard scoring run.Defensively, UNLV’s front seven was a disruptive force, sacking Barnes seven times, with defensive lineman Tunmise Adeleye notching two and linebacker Marsel McDuffie continuing his tackling clinic with ten total stops. While the unit surrendered over 400 yards, they embodied the 'bend-don't-break' philosophy, making critical stops when the field shortened and the pressure mounted, a characteristic often separating mediocre teams from contenders.The victory, ultimately sealed by wide receiver Kayden McGee on a determined, pylon-diving handoff in the second overtime, propels UNLV into a critical final stretch. The upcoming clash against the formidable 7-3 Hawai’i Rainbow Warriors now carries immense weight, not just for conference standings but for the program's momentum. This win, snatched from the jaws of defeat through a combination of resilience, opportunistic defense, and sheer fortune, is the kind of character-building moment that can define a season, a reminder that in the chaotic theatre of college football, survival sometimes trumps domination.
